I was wondering the following: If I would go to a tournament with a few Rat Darts made from the Plaguemonk and Doomwheel boxes will this be accepted? The rats are quite big alot bigger then the rats from the ratswarms but also slightly smaller then the ones in the Ratogre box. I have about 24 of these rats so it would save me quite alot of money to use them as giant rats, would just hate if people would cry about it at tourneys. Also how many ratdarts do you guys usually take with you in 2500 games? Edited by Skrits, 16th September 2011 - 09:43 AM.

Plenty of people use these as giant rats. I don't even think most players would notice the difference, so knock yourself out ![]() Regarding number of rat darts I would say 3-4 at 2500 points seems fairly standard. that should be enough to give you a deployment advantage, but not so many that they become a liability (with respect to panic tests). |

The Plague Monk Giant Rats are a bit smaller but the ones on the Doomwheel are exactly the same size, and in some cases, the same models, as the Rat Pack/Ogre box. So definitely use them! And thanks, Flem, you just reminded me to go raid my old VC sprues
